Add to basketPaperback. Condition: new. Paperback. 'The Penguin That Can Code - The First Coding Adventure' is the story about a little penguin and his Dad. They live in Iceville, a beautiful polar village somewhere in the Antarctic. While all the other penguins in Iceville catch fish, Daddy Penguin codes, and this fact is not approved much by the fellow penguins. The other penguins in his place don't have much idea about coding. And then suddenly, the penguins of Iceville are having a hard time, since they are not able to find enough fish. As the story proceeds, the little penguin accidentally finds a place that has lots of fish and with the help of Daddy Penguin and some coding they are able to bring enough fish to Iceville which makes Daddy Penguin a hero.There is even a fun snippet of code included in the story for little ones. Join Daddy Penguin Pete and little Oliver as they build, code, and test a special sled train for the little penguins of Iceville, for it is the beginning of summer in the beautiful polar village.'The Penguin That Can Code - Coding A Train Ride' is the second book in the series 'The Penguin That Can Code' and it covers all the five phases of the software development life cycle including planning, creating, coding, testing and deploying any application, in the most gentle, generic and entertaining way for the littlest of the readers, as they enjoy the story about the penguins celebrating a fun summer in Iceville. Includes a kid-friendly snippet of code. Perfect for ages 3-9. This item is printed on demand.
